What we rewrite
Section 1
Headline
The most important 220 characters on your profile. It appears in every search result, every connection request, and every message you send. Most people write their job title. We write a searchable, compelling statement that tells recruiters exactly who you are and what you offer.
Section 2
About Section
Your career narrative, not your CV summary. The about section is the only place on LinkedIn where you can tell your story in full sentences. We write it in first person, in your voice, structured to hook a reader in the first two lines and deliver your value proposition clearly by the end.
Section 3
Experience Section
Achievement-led, not duty lists. Each role gets a brief context statement and two to four bullet points that lead with impact and include numbers where available. LinkedIn experience entries are also indexed by the algorithm, so we incorporate the right keywords without making the copy feel optimised.
Section 4
Skills Section
Keyword-matched to your target roles. LinkedIn's skills section directly influences which recruiter searches you appear in. We research the skills most commonly listed by people in your target roles and build a skills section that aligns your profile with those searches.
Section 5
Featured Section
What to put here and what to avoid. The featured section sits at the top of your profile and is prime visibility real estate. We advise on what to feature based on your career level and target roles, and what to leave out to avoid cluttering your profile with irrelevant content.
Section 6
Recommendations
How to get them and what they should say. A LinkedIn recommendation from the right person carries more weight than a dozen endorsements. We advise on who to ask, how to ask, and what to suggest they include so that the recommendation actively supports your positioning rather than just saying you were pleasant to work with.
